About Alex Broun
Born in Sydney, Australia, Alex has enjoyed considerable success in theatre, TV and film as a writer, actor and director and worked extensively as an activist for refugee rights with the Refugee Action Coalition (RAC).
One of the world's leading ten minute playwrights, Alex has had over 70 ten minute plays produced in over 600 productions all over the world in countries including Australia, Canada, China, India, Japan, Malaysia, Pakistan, Philippines, Singapore, South Africa, Taiwan, UK and the USA. To date his work has been produced in 17 different countries.
Recently he has had short plays produced in Hungary, Romania and Concepcion in Chile where a play was used by a local theatre group "to bring some joy to the community" after the devastating earthquakes.
Some of his plays were recently translated into Spanish and sent down to the trapped miners in Chile for them to read while they waited to be rescued and a collection of his short plays was translated into Persian and published in Iran.
His most popular play 10,000 cigarettes has had over 100 productions across the globe including being produced in 42 states of the USA.
His longer plays have also been performed around the world including South Africa, UK, USA and around Australia including at La Mama, the Old Fitzroy, Chapel Off Chapel, the Darlinghurst Theatre, Newtown Theatre, the Brisbane Powerhouse, the Arts Centre in Melbourne and Belvoir Street.
He has had plays workshopped and developed by the Sydney Theatre Company, Playwriting Australia and the Australian National Playwright's Conference as well as being a former winner of the Sydney Theatre Company Young Playwright's Scheme and Inscription (twice).
He has also twice received funding from the Australian Film Commission as well as recently having numerous short screenplays filmed.
He has been heavily involved in the development and growth of Short+Sweet, the largest ten minute play festival in the world that currently plays in Sydney, Melbourne, Brisbane, Canberra, the Central Coast of NSW, Gippsland, Rockhampton, Newcastle, Auckland, Singapore, Malaysia and soon Delhi.
